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 8 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 8
500 ml bottle, from the brewery webshop. ABV is 5.8%. Hazy golden colour, moderate white head. Aroma of brettanomyces / farmhouse, lemons, oak and citric hops. Dry and medium sour flavour, notes of brett, oak and lemons. Nice beer.

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 8 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 7.5
Keg at Fierce. It pours clear yellow golden with a small white head. The aroma is bright white grape character upfront, gooseberry crumble, funk dungeon, brett, juicy fruit chewing gum, bubblegum, Irn Bru, wet hay, musty, damp grass, jelly beans and gummy bears. The taste is dryish upfront, bitter funk, plenty of brett, citrus peel, pithy citrus, tannin, gooseberry, white grape, white wine spritzer, soda water and lime and hay with a shirt, funky finish. Medium body and fine, prickly. Loving the aroma, but surprised by that short finish. Decent anyhow.
